Serenoa Serrulata Fruit Extract
Good

Serenoa Serrulata Fruit Extract, also known as saw palmetto extract, is used for its potential to inhibit hair loss. It is believed to block the conversion of testosterone to DHT, a hormone linked to hair thinning. This ingredient is popular in hair care products targeting hair loss.

Benefits

May help reduce hair loss and promote thicker hair growth.

Fragrance
Bad

Fragrance is used to impart a pleasant scent to the product, but it can contain a mixture of undisclosed chemicals. These chemicals may cause allergic reactions or skin irritation in sensitive individuals. The lack of transparency in fragrance formulations is a concern for consumers with sensitivities.

Risks

May cause allergic reactions or skin irritation in sensitive individuals.

Limonene
Bad

Limonene is a fragrance component derived from citrus fruits, used for its pleasant scent. It can oxidize and become a skin sensitizer, potentially causing allergic reactions. While it is naturally derived, its potential to cause irritation is a concern for sensitive individuals.

Risks

May cause skin irritation or allergic reactions in sensitive individuals.
